I just tried Jamstox again with n-Track and it seems to be more stable with the latest build of n-track (build 1805).
I am having 2 problems though that I have mailed Flavio the N-track developer about but I'll post them here as well as I'm not sure if they are Jamstix or n-Track issues....
when using Jamstix with n-Track the audio output of Jamstix only comes out of the left channel.
Using Jamstix in Tracktion it comes out both channels fine. I don't like Tracktion though so was only using it to Test Jamstix and want to be able to use it in n-Track
Also when using Jamstix if you press stop in n-track and then move the position marker and press play it seems that sometimes the information about what bar the song is up to is sent to Jamstix and sometimes it isn't.
ie. Sometimes Jamestix will change to the correct bar and play from there and sometimes it just keeps playing from the bar that you stopped the song before moving the position marker in n-track.
The second issue is not that much of a problem as a workaround is to just manually set Jamstix to the correct bar, but the first one is a major problem as I obviously don't want mono drum tracks
Rich |
